Starting the New Year 2011 with a good news!
”Staff and students at the School of Education have raised £42,000 to start a school in rural Nepal for children who have no access to education. The school, in the hamlet of Malagiri, will open in April 2011 and money raised is being used for the school construction, equipment and for salaries”. 
”Three trainee teachers, Camille Montgomery, Sarah Davies and Katie Kilbey, visited the site this year and six more students will be visiting Nepal in February 2011 to undertake placements in Kathmandu and the surrounding area”.
